NomadHer is an innovative community app designed for global female travelers, and it is one of the startups gaining attention recently. NomadHer won the Women Impact Startup category at the '2023 UN Impact Tourism Startup Competition,' recognizing its achievements worldwide.

The main feature of NomadHer is its travel companion matching service based on identity verification. This service provides safe and reliable companions for female travelers, focusing on solving various safety issues they may encounter during their travels. A significant advantage is that only verified women can find companions through its unique identity verification algorithm. This provides security and reliability beyond a simple user profile, gaining substantial positive feedback from many female travelers.

Currently, NomadHer has over 400,000 global female users, with the primary usage region being the United States. It records the highest traffic around New York and San Francisco. Through its participation in CES 2025, NomadHer plans to communicate more deeply with the global female community.

Additionally, NomadHer was selected as one of the 10 notable travel startups in France by the French hotel chain Accor and Havas Media in 2024, solidifying its presence in Europe. Such accolades demonstrate that NomadHer is recognized in the global market for its genuine approach to female travelers.

Through its participation in CES 2025, NomadHer aims to communicate directly with consumers and increase brand awareness in the B2C market. At CES 2025, you can meet CEO Hyojeong Kim at Eureka Park booth 63416-04.

Looking at NomadHer's growth status, it is actively used globally, with customers from the U.S. and Western Europe making up 98% and about 2% from Korea. Its main partners range from cities attracting tourists to hotels and airport duty-free shops. NomadHer is participating in the CES 2025 Seoul Integrated Pavilion to advance into the Korean market and attract collaborations with companies targeting female travelers as customers.

NomadHer’s philosophy is to create a space where women can travel safely and enjoyably. Inspired by her solo travel experience, CEO Hyojeong Kim founded this platform to address the safety issues women face when traveling alone.
